Premium 3D architectural rendering services involve a meticulous process. It starts with collecting architectural illustrations, CAD files, or concept sketches. Designers then translate these into comprehensive 3D models, including textures, lighting results, and surrounding landscape components. Advanced rendering techniques are used to produce images that closely duplicate real-world appearances. These outputs serve several functions-- from marketing sales brochures and online portfolios to preparing presentations and investor pitches.

Additionally, the accessibility of 3D architectural rendering has actually broadened substantially with improvements in innovation. Cloud-based rendering, AI-assisted modelling, and GPU acceleration have made high-quality renders faster and more cost-effective to produce. Customers can now team up in real-time, asking for changes or offering feedback remotely, which streamlines the workflow and lowers turn-around time.
Sustainability and environmental effect assessments also gain from exact visualisations. 3D renderings can demonstrate how a building interacts with natural light, shadowing, and the surrounding environment. This level of detail supports ecologically conscious design choices and adds to green building certifications.
